Jeremiah 8:18-20
New Century Version
Jeremiah’s Sadness
18 God, you are my comfort when I am very sad
and when I am afraid.
19 Listen to the sound of my people.
They cry from a faraway land:
“Isn’t the Lord still in Jerusalem?
Isn’t Jerusalem’s king still there?”
But God says, “Why did the people make me angry by worshiping idols,
useless foreign idols?”
20 And the people say, “Harvest time is over;
summer has ended,
and we have not been saved.”
Jeremiah 8:18-20
New International Version
18 You who are my Comforter[a] in sorrow,
my heart is faint(A) within me.
19 Listen to the cry of my people
from a land far away:(B)
“Is the Lord not in Zion?
Is her King(C) no longer there?”
20 “The harvest is past,
the summer has ended,
and we are not saved.”
